Hatching eggs from my NPIP certified flock of super rare harlequin Indian runner ducks. Eight year project finally going public. I have 20 hens, and 5 drakes. All hens are either silver or gold phase harlequin-colored Indian Runners. The drakes are: 3 silver phase harlequin runner, one blue harlequin runner, and one Saxony runner. The 2 blue (Saxony and blue harlequin) drakes are for my next project: Overberg-colored runners. You may get some blue harlequins in your hatch, or some dusky's that carry harlequin. My flock also tends to produce some very nice white offspring.
